ITEM awarded SWOL grant for cross-border research by students
The Limburg University Fund/SWOL has awarded a grant of 5000 euros for bachelor’s students to conduct research into the internationalisation of small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) in the Dutch border provinces of Limburg and Drenthe.

Eefje de Bont awarded 2 prestigious NHG prizes
During the NHG Science Day, Eefje de Bont won the NHG Science Prize for her article on the study of the effect of an information booklet for parents of children with fever.

Inge van der Putten nominated for the NVTAG prize 2018
Inge van der Putten is one of the nominees to win the HTA prize 2018 of the Dutch Society for Technology Assessment in Health Care (NVTAG) for her article “Evidence-informed vaccine decision making: The introduction of Human Papilloma Virus (HPV) vaccination in the Netherlands”
